How to Make Cheesy Steak Pinwheels
Ingredients:
- Center cut beef tenderloin
- Mustard
- Cheese (your choice, e.g., mozzarella or cheddar)
- Prosciutto
- Skewers
- Spicy Gremolata (parsley, garlic, lemon zest, olive oil, and chili flakes)
Directions:
- Preheat the grill.
- Fillet the center cut beef tenderloin, making a pocket for the filling.
- Spread mustard inside the pocket, then layer with cheese and prosciutto.
- Roll the beef tightly and secure with skewers.
- Slice into individual pinwheels.
- Grill on medium-high heat for about 4-5 minutes per side or until cooked to desired doneness.
- Serve topped with Spicy Gremolata.

How to Store Cheesy Steak Pinwheels
If you have leftovers, let the pinwheels cool down to room temperature. Place them in an airtight container and store them in the refrigerator. They will stay fresh for up to 3 days. You can reheat them in a skillet or microwave before serving again.
Tips to Make Cheesy Steak Pinwheels
- Choose the right cut of beef: Center cut tenderloin is tender and flavorful, making it the best choice.
- Use a sharp knife for filleting to create an even pocket for the filling.
- Don’t overfill the pinwheels to prevent them from bursting during grilling.

FAQs
1. Can I use a different cut of beef?
Yes, you can use ribeye or flank steak, but make sure to adjust the cooking time as they may cook faster or slower.
2. Is it possible to make these pinwheels ahead of time?
Yes, you can prepare the pinwheels and refrigerate them for a few hours before grilling. Just remember to cook them fresh for best results.
